Why Is Fear Important In Life?

Fear is an important emotion that serves as a natural response to perceived threats or danger. It helps to protect us by alerting us to potential dangers and preparing us to take action to avoid or confront them. Fear can also motivate us to work hard and persevere in the face of challenges. For example, if we are afraid of failing a test, we may study harder to prepare for it. Fear can also help us to make decisions that are in our best interest, such as choosing to wear a seatbelt when driving a car or avoiding risky behaviors that could lead to harm. While fear can be uncomfortable and unpleasant, it is an essential part of being human and helps us to navigate the world safely.

How Do You Explain Fear?

Fear is an emotional response to a perceived threat. It is a natural, automatic response that occurs in the presence of something that is potentially dangerous, scary, or threatening. Fear is a primal emotion that has evolved as a way to protect us from harm. When we feel fear, our bodies activate the "fight or flight" response, which prepares us to defend ourselves or flee from danger. Fear can be triggered by a wide range of stimuli, including certain sights, sounds, or situations. It can also be learned through experience, such as when we associate a particular stimulus with a negative outcome.

Why Is It Important To Overcome Fear?

Fear can be a natural and healthy response to certain situations, as it helps to keep us safe and alert. However, fear can also hold us back and prevent us from achieving our goals or living our lives to the fullest. When fear becomes overwhelming or irrational, it can interfere with our daily functioning and well-being.

Overcoming fear is important because it allows us to take control of our lives and pursue our aspirations. It can also help us to feel more confident and self-assured, and to build resilience in the face of challenges. By facing our fears, we can learn to manage them and develop the skills and resources needed to cope with difficult situations. This can lead to greater personal growth and fulfillment.

Essay About Fear

Fear is a natural emotion that is characterized by feelings of anxiety, worry, and anticipation of danger. It is an essential part of the body's defense mechanism, as it helps us to recognize and respond to potential threats. Fear can motivate us to take action, such as running away from danger or preparing to protect ourselves.
However, fear can also be irrational and debilitating. It can lead us to avoid necessary or meaningful activities, or it can interfere with our ability to think clearly and make decisions. It can also cause physical symptoms such as a racing heart, shortness of breath, and tense muscles.
There are many different things that people can fear, including physical dangers, social situations, and abstract concepts. Some common fears include fear of heights, fear of public speaking, fear of failure, and fear of the unknown.
